  25. Adding lift...

    If you're wanting 2" more, better off looking/making 2" lift blocks to place between the leafs and axle. It's a lot safer than using an add-a-leaf, which you can still do. Over 6" you're going to have axle wrap if you're on the throttle hard. Look at installing some traction bars to keep the...
